C++ 作用域

namespace类型

namespace在C++中表征C++的作用域

运算符

在C++中可以对namespace类型变量进行赋值操作例如:

namespace TV = Televison

###声明作用于
C++提供using关键字,通过using namespace xxxx来声明作用域,经过这种声明方式后在该文件用到的该作用域的函数不用再显示声明。但是当在同一作用域中多次使用using声明的时候要确保不同的空间不会有同名函数,不然会出现二义性而报错。
###无名作用域
C++支持无名作用于,由于无名作用于无法引用,所以其作用于仅限于该文件

猜你喜欢

转载自blog.csdn.net/yzcwansui/article/details/84705604